]> git.wh0rd.org - tt-rss.git/blobdiff - include/functions2.php
Fixed height/width image attributes for enclosures.
[tt-rss.git] / include / functions2.php
index 19012c8e27a7ee933105eb12bf12e27778f3957c..a135049a585a058b1214733897f2fdda960a4646 100644 (file)
 
        function search_to_sql($search, $search_language) {
 
-               $keywords = str_getcsv($search, " ");
+               $keywords = str_getcsv(trim($search), " ");
                $query_keywords = array();
                $search_words = array();
                $search_query_leftover = array();
                        $tags_str = "";
 
                        for ($i = 0; $i < $maxtags; $i++) {
-                               $tags_str .= "<a class=\"tag\" href=\"#\" onclick=\"viewfeed('".$tags[$i]."')\">" . $tags[$i] . "</a>, ";
+                               $tags_str .= "<a class=\"tag\" href=\"#\" onclick=\"viewfeed({feed:'".$tags[$i]."'})\">" . $tags[$i] . "</a>, ";
                        }
 
                        $tags_str = mb_substr($tags_str, 0, mb_strlen($tags_str)-2);
                                $rv = $retval;
                        }
                }
+               unset($retval); // Unset to prevent breaking render if there are no HOOK_RENDER_ENCLOSURE hooks below.
 
                if ($rv === '' && !empty($result)) {
                        $entries_html = array();
                                                                        if (!$hide_images) {
                                                                                $encsize = '';
                                                                                if ($entry['height'] > 0)
-                                                                                       $encsize .= ' height="' . intval($entry['width']) . '"';
+                                                                                       $encsize .= ' height="' . intval($entry['height']) . '"';
                                                                                if ($entry['width'] > 0)
-                                                                                       $encsize .= ' width="' . intval($entry['height']) . '"';
+                                                                                       $encsize .= ' width="' . intval($entry['width']) . '"';
                                                                                $rv .= "<p><img
                                                                                alt=\"".htmlspecialchars($entry["filename"])."\"
                                                                                src=\"" .htmlspecialchars($entry["url"]) . "\"
                curl_setopt($curl, CURLOPT_RETURNTRANSFER, true);
                //curl_setopt($curl, CURLOPT_FOLLOWLOCATION, true); //CURLOPT_FOLLOWLOCATION Disabled...
                curl_setopt($curl, CURLOPT_TIMEOUT, 60);
-               curl_setopt($curl, CURLOPT_SSL_VERIFYPEER, false);
 
                if (defined('_CURL_HTTP_PROXY')) {
                        curl_setopt($curl, CURLOPT_PROXY, _CURL_HTTP_PROXY);